Abstract

Using soil as a construction material for masonry works have been indigenous technology. The present research investigates on use of sisal fibres and cement additives to enhance compressive strength of properties of mud block to advance traditional native knowledge and meet current construction material standard qualities. An experiment with total of twenty-four mixes consisting of 96 blocks was designed with mixes of 0% to 15% cement; 0% to 1.25% sisal fiber proportional to clay soil dry mass. At 28 days, compressive strength and density tests were performed as per ASTM standards. Test results showed use of sisal fibers and cement increased compressive strength of mud blocks up to 210.1%. Optimum mix design for enhanced mud block compressive strength performance were 10% cement and 1% sisal fiber composition.
